Parentification or parent–child role reversal is the process of role reversal whereby a child or adolescent is obliged to support the family system in ways that are developmentally inappropriate and overly burdensome.
Sissy is 25, but, in a way, she has always been an adult. When a call from her sister, Bug, arrives in the night, Sissy must come to terms with all the years that came before.
As the lines between childhood and parenthood continue to blur, the messy threads of a childhood cut short begin to unravel, and hopes for a better future may be rooted in the past.
